Transaction ffab51f6e7d37f74640bbe2363324b1150527ec0161452cd5abd72cc41e1b412

2 Input
2 Outputs
  • ffab51f6e7d37f74640bbe2363324b1150527ec0161452cd5abd72cc41e1b412:0
  • value  3904
    address  bc1qfa3lx6t843y8t78427tyt0qxjc2e8cqq780p6e
  • ffab51f6e7d37f74640bbe2363324b1150527ec0161452cd5abd72cc41e1b412:1
  • value  490000
    address  14YPsuWYHDErhyTanYhGVRVYHFGbaWwWiW